#4c2c26 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c2c26 is composed of 29.8% red, 17.3%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 50%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 9.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 22.4%. #4c2c26 color hex could be obtained by blending #98584c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#4c2c26 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#4c2c26 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c2c26 has RGB values of R:76, G:44,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.5,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 4992038.
